Do You Really Need Unlimited Data?
Before diving into the best eSIM providers, consider whether you actually need unlimited data. Many travelers and digital nomads find that 10GB to 20GB per month is sufficient for navigation, emails, and occasional streaming. If you’re constantly downloading large files, streaming in high definition, or using data-heavy applications, then an unlimited plan might be worth it.
However, “unlimited” doesn’t always mean truly unlimited. Many providers have a Fair Use Policy (FUP) that throttles your data speeds after a certain limit (usually 1GB to 3GB per day). This means that even if you have an unlimited plan, your speeds may be significantly reduced after you hit the daily cap.

How to Buy and Activate an eSIM for Unlimited Data
Setting up an eSIM is quick and easy compared to traditional SIM cards. Here’s how you can get started:
- Choose an eSIM provider – Based on your travel needs, select the best eSIM provider from the list above.
- Purchase a plan – Go to the provider’s website and choose the unlimited data plan that best fits your budget and requirements.
- Receive the QR code – After purchasing, the provider will send you a QR code via email or in their app.
- Activate the eSIM – On your smartphone:
- Go to Settings > Cellular > Add Cellular Plan
- Scan the QR code
- Follow the setup instructions
- Set the eSIM as your primary data source – Under Settings, ensure that your eSIM is selected as your primary mobile data connection.
- Manage data usage – To optimize data usage and avoid throttling, enable Low Data Mode on iOS:
- Go to Settings > Cellular > Select your eSIM line > Data Mode > Enable Low Data Mode
